Saleh letter to UAE leadership
[19/October/2009]

ABU DHABI, Oct. 19 (Saba) - Commander of the Republican Guard Ahmed Ali Abdullah Saleh has paid along with an accompanying a visit to the United Arab Emirates.

During the one-day visit, Saleh met with Supreme Commander of the UAE Army and Crown Prince of Abu Dhabi Emirate Mohammed Bin Zayed Al Nahyan, handing a letter from President Ali Abdullah Saleh to the leadership of the Untied Arab Emirates concerning the bilateral relationship and issues of mutual interest.

The meeting dealt with mutual cooperation between the two brotherly states, particularly in the security and military areas.

Saleh left for the country on Sunday along with the accompanying delegation.
